Mockingbirds are extremely territorial and will click here become aggressive if other birds or animals approach their place. Aggression is very apparent through nesting season, as equally moms and dads will protect their nesting mocking bird region and hatchlings from other birds. Women will attack other female birds, although males attack male birds that enter the region.
